Title :
Design of a freely-rotary fiber-optic accelerometer with liquid mass

Abstract :
A kind of freely-rotary fiber-optic accelerometer with liquid mass is designed, the design constitution of this sensor cantilever and the work principle analysis of corresponding to this sensor cantilever is given, the mathematical relationships between acceleration signal and the output phase are presented. Explaining the characteristic of this kind of freely-rotary fiber-optic accelerometer with liquid mass, it can detects the acceleration at the level 360 degree and the vertical direction.
